This course introduces cadets to the interdisciplinary nature of decision-making by addressing how leaders make decisions in situations of incomplete, conflicting, and incorrect information using forecasting, modeling, and gaming. The curriculum enables cadets to synthesize long-term developments and potential future scenarios through forecasting and trend analysis. It requires cadets to apply lessons in a series of complex, competitive games. Cadets will leave the class with a basic understanding of the complexities involved in strategic decision-making and methods to frame, understand, and address that complexity. |
